During the summer of 2000, alumni from the past three decades joined the 62 participants of MITE2S 2000 in a weekend event "Celebrating 25 Years of Cultivating the Future." Among the nearly 200 attendees marking this milestone were sponsors, former MITE2S staff, and guests.
In two riveting panel discussions, alumni shared the impact the program had on their personal and professional development, and the social and cultural barriers they faced and overcame to succeed in science and engineering.
The weekend gave the students, alumni, sponsors, staff and guests an opportunity to get inspired, share success stories, and renew old (and form new) friendships. Moreover, it was a time to celebrate the program's past achievements and lay out the vision for its futureto double the size of the summer program, to introduce new engineering disciplines into the Engineering Design curriculum, and to launch a Saturday academy for local high school students. The staff of the MITE2S Program was both delighted and heartened by the enthusiastic participation of alumni and sponsors at the celebration.
